In other words, a rational number is negative, if its numerator and denominator are of the opposite signs. Each of the rational numbers −1/6,2/−7,−30/11 13/−19,−15/23 are negative rationals, but −11/−18 2/5,−3/−5,1/3 are not negative rationals
